Adversaries may employ a known symmetric encryption algorithm to conceal command and control traffic rather than relying on any inherent protections provided by a communication protocol. Symmetric encryption algorithms use the same key for plaintext encryption and ciphertext decryption. Common symmetric encryption algorithms include AES, DES, 3DES, Blowfish, and RC4.
ESXi daemons (hostd, vpxa) unexpectedly using symmetric encryption routines for external connections. Defender identifies logs of service traffic with encrypted payloads inconsistent with VMware management baselines.
Launchd jobs or user processes invoking symmetric crypto APIs from the Security framework and generating outbound connections carrying randomized payloads inconsistent with normal TLS patterns.
Processes that typically do not perform cryptographic operations loading symmetric encryption libraries (e.g., bcryptprimitives.dll, aes.dll), then initiating outbound connections with high-entropy payloads. Defender correlates process creation, DLL load, and anomalous encrypted traffic patterns.
